Coronavirus undergoes more frequent mutations over time. It is well
understood with previous outbreaks of the diseases, like the severe acute respiratory
syndrome (SARS) and the Middle East respiratory syndrome-coronavirus (MERSCoV).
The behavior and pattern of diseases change with the mutation, and the virus
becomes a new virus of its out kind regarding morbidity and mortality. Virus from
different origins has been observed to have mutations at various places of their genome
resulting in changed disease pattern resulting in the worldwide outbreak of the
coronavirus disease-19 (COVID-19). Mutation in coronavirus is a slow and emerging
process that may be responsible for the modulation of viral transmission, virulence, and
replication efficiency in different regions of the globe. SARS-CoV-2 is going to spread
around the world, and novel mutation hotspots are emerging in the genome. There has
been increasing in the genetic diversity of coronavirus in human hosts. Random
mutations cause the diversification of the virus leading to drug resistance, the changed
pathogenicity and infectivity. This variation could remain in the virus, but it could be
transferred to the next generation. The study was conducted to focus on viral evolution
through mutation in various geographic regions of the world.
